About Dr William Chung

Dr. William Chung is a Gastroenterologist, Hepatologist, and Endoscopist, serving as a consultant specialist at the Austin Hospital and The Royal Melbourne Hospital. With a medical degree from the University of Melbourne, Dr. Chung is currently pursuing a PhD in liver cancer research.

Dr. Chung has a wide-ranging expertise encompassing hepatology, endoscopy, inflammatory bowel disease, bowel cancer screening, liver cancer screening and treatment, viral hepatitis (hepatitis B and C), non-alcoholic fatty liver disease, iron deficiency anaemia, gastroesophageal reflux disease, and irritable bowel syndrome. He dedicates his time to clinical care and research, ensuring comprehensive management for his patients.

Regularly visiting Goulburn Valley Health, Shepparton for clinics and endoscopy lists, Dr. Chung has contributed significantly to the development of an Inflammatory Bowel Disease service at the facility, enhancing patient care in the region.

Dr. Chung has undertaken training across Australia, America and the UK, He completed a Senior Clinical Fellowship in Hepatology and Liver Transplantation at the Royal Free Hospital in London, United Kingdom (2019-2020). Additionally, he undertook a month-long observership at the Gastroenterology department at Addenbrooke's Hospital, Cambridge University, United Kingdom (2014). Dr. Chung's dedication to learning and collaboration is further highlighted by his sub-internship at Brigham and Women's Hospital, Harvard Medical School, Boston, United States, during medical school, where he received high honours and commendations.

What is SIBO?

What is SIBO?

Small Intestinal Bacterial Overgrowth (SIBO) occurs when bacteria from the colon migrate into and colonize the small intestine, causing excessive fermentation, bloating, abdominal pain, diarrhea, and nutritional deficiencies.

What is a Hiatus Hernia? A Dr Chung explains

What is a Hiatus Hernia? A Dr Chung explains

A hiatal hernia occurs when the upper part of the stomach pushes up through a weakened opening in the diaphragm (the hiatus) into the chest cavity. Common in people over 50, this condition often causes acid reflux, heartburn, and chest pain, or may have no symptoms at all.

What is Alcohol-Related Liver Disease? Causes & Symptoms Explained

What is Alcohol-Related Liver Disease? Causes & Symptoms Explained

Alcohol-related liver disease is damage to the liver caused by long-term or excessive alcohol use. It can range from fatty liver to inflammation (hepatitis) and, in severe cases, cirrhosis. Common symptoms include tiredness, yellowing of the skin (jaundice), abdominal pain, and swelling. Early detection and stopping alcohol intake can help prevent further liver damage.

What is Rectal Bleeding?

What is Rectal Bleeding?

Rectal bleeding is the presence of blood from the rectum, often noticed in stool, on toilet paper, or in the toilet bowl. It can be caused by conditions like hemorrhoids, anal fissures, infections, or more serious issues such as inflammatory bowel disease or polyps. Any persistent or heavy bleeding should be checked by a doctor.
